Home blood pressure best guide to metabolic risk

Posted: 19 Jan 2014 04:00 PM PST

Home blood pressure is a good guide to which patients are likely to have the metabolic syndrome, say researchers.

Clinical rule stratifies CAP patients’ cardiac risk

Posted: 19 Jan 2014 04:00 PM PST

Researchers have generated and validated a clinical rule that accurately stratifies patients hospitalized for community acquired pneumonia according to their risk for cardiac complications.

Oral opioid use sufficient following cardiac surgery

Posted: 19 Jan 2014 04:00 PM PST

Oral opioids are as effective as intravenous opioids for relieving pain in patients who have undergone cardiac surgery, randomized trial findings show.

Nomogram predicts overdiagnosis in prostate cancer screening

Posted: 19 Jan 2014 04:00 PM PST

US researchers have developed a nomogram which they say can be used to predict whether prostate cancer has been overdiagnosed in individual patients diagnosed following prostate-specific antigen screening.

Daytime water restriction effective in nocturia

Posted: 19 Jan 2014 04:00 PM PST

Researchers from Japan say that some men with nocturia should be advised to restrict their fluid intake during the day and not just at night.
